Usually, ghost town ruins right on a major modern highway are either hardly recognizable, or else are all "touristy." The ruins at Palmetto, however, are perfectly obvious from the highway and have no fences, admission fees, or souvenir shops. And they don't require miles of rough 4WD road to reach. Silver was first struck here in 1866, and in a typical burst of overoptimism, a 12-stamp mill was built. There was not enough ore to keep the mill busy, however, and Palmetto was soon abandoned.
